|   c1919 Drill hall-Wilson Recreation reserve-emergency hospital-Brighton

      Description: Sepia & white photograph shows the interior of Drill hall set up as emergency hospital to cope with the influenza epidemic of 1919. This interesting photo shows the stage of the drill hall and the meagre floral arrangements of the period.
